Autumn Harvest Reserve

2006 New Jersey Red Blend

The Brook Hollow Winery Autumn Harvest Reserve is a captivating red blend from the 2006 vintage, sourced from the picturesque vineyards of New Jersey. This wine showcases a deep, vibrant red color that hints at its rich character. On the palate, it offers a well-rounded experience with a pleasing balance of fruit intensity and essential tannins that provide structure without overpowering the senses. Its acidity is bright, adding a refreshing lift that complements the layers of dark fruit flavors, including blackberries and plums, intertwined with subtle hints of spice. This wine is wonderfully dry, making it an excellent choice for pairing with hearty dishes or enjoying on its own during a cozy autumn evening. The Autumn Harvest Reserve reflects the distinct terroir of New Jersey, elevating it to a delightful expression of the region's winegrowing potential.

New Jersey, nestled between the Atlantic Ocean and the dense forests of the east coast, is a vibrant and diverse winegrowing region. The state’s American Viticultural Areas (AVAs) are influenced by a mix of Atlantic breezes and the moderate climate provided by its proximity to water. These conditions temper the seasonal extremes, allowing for a longer growing season. The cool air from the ocean and the rivers moderates the vineyards, enabling grapes to ripen steadily, developing rich flavors and balanced acidity. Vineyards closer to the coast excel with cooler-climate varietals that produce refined and elegant wines, while the more protected inland areas nurture bolder, more robust varieties.
